Question : Bridging the digital divide requires:

 

Option 1: Reducing investment in technology 

Option 2: Increasing access to digital literacy  

Option 3: Limiting internet connectivity 

Option 4: Focusing solely on urban areas

Correct Answer: Increasing access to digital literacy  


Solution : Bridging the digital divide requires increasing access to digital literacy, ensuring that individuals have the skills and knowledge to effectively use digital technologies, alongside efforts to improve infrastructure and affordability.
